Strengthening pupils’ reading skills
Following the pandemic, the school identified a decline in pupils’ skills and enjoyment of reading. In response, teachers developed and implemented a rich variety of interesting challenges such as ‘Drop Everything and Read’ (DEAR) and the ’25 Book Challenge’ to rekindle their enthusiasm and love for reading. This has led to a strong culture of reading which ensures that most pupils’ make strong progress in developing their reading skills and apply these skills effectively across the curriculum.
